Septic Tank Safe Drain Unblocking?

Chaos_Monkey
Posts: 158 Forumite
Hi All you lovely people
I hope I've got the right place.....
Basically, we're having a problem with the bath/shower draining VERY slowly, and water from the sink coming back up the bath plughole (quite gross!).
This leads me to believe we've got a problem with/at the connection of the pipes between the sink and the bath.......I don't think it's simply badly designed (but that's probably a contributing factor - the rest of the house has aspects like that!), but I supsect it's due to 'gunk' buildup. :think:
I've tried soda crystals and hot water, which helps nominally. Does anyone have any other suggestions? We're on a septic tank, which complicates things!

remove and clean any traps under the sink and bath.
also clean out the waste pipes with a drain wire. whilst you have easy access.
do the waste pipes join the main stink pipe?Get some gorm.0 -
